ORDINANCE NO. a0,3f4
AN ORDINANCE of the City of Port Angeles
defining acceptable methods of security
for insuring the completion of improve-
ments in approved subdivisions, and
amending Ordinance No. 1631.
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F PORT
ANGELES, as follows:
Section 1. Section 4 of Ordinance No. 1631 is hereby
amended to read as follows:
"PRELIMINARY STEPS The developer shall submit a
Sketch of his proposed subdivision of land to the Subdi-
vision Administrator for his review prior to submittal of
the Preliminary Plat.
CONDITIONAL APPROVAL The developer or his surveyor
shall then transmit six* (6) copies of his Preliminary
plat, accompanied by a $5 -per -lot Subdivision Fee, (over
20 lots, the additional fee shall be $1.00 per lot), to
the Subdivision Administrator. The City Engineer shall
submit his written recommendations to the Planning Com-
mission prior to the Commission's public hearing in which
the Preliminary plat is on its agenda.
The proposed plat shall be prepared by a licensed
land surveyor and small be submitted to the Subdivision
Administrator at least fourteen days prior to the next
public hearing of the City Planning Commission.
Notice of the public hearing on a proposed plat or
subdivision shall be posted by the developer and shall
consist of at least three copies of the notice of the
hearing, posted in conspicuous places on or adjacent to
the land proposed to be subdivided. Such notices shall
clearly indicate the time and place of such hearing and
such notices shall be posted not less than seven days
prior to the hearing.
Within a period of sixty days after a Preliminary
plat has been submitted to the Subdivision Administrator
the Planning Commission shall examine the proposed plat,
along with written recommendations of the City Manager
and the City Engineer, and shall either approve or dis-
approve and shall make recommendations thereon.
If the recommendations of the City Manager or City
Engineer are not followed, the City Manager can appeal
the Planning Commission's recommendation to the Council.
Within fourteen days following final action of the
Commission on a Preliminary plat the Commission shall
notify the developer regarding changes required and the
type and extent of improvements to be made. A copy of
the Commission's action and recommendations shall be
forwarded to the developer and to any agency submitting
recommendations in regard to the Preliminary plat.
Approval of a Preliminary plat shall be considered
Conditional Approval of the Preliminary plat, and shall
not constitute approval of the Final plat; it shall be
considered only as approval of the layout submitted on
the Preliminary plat as a guide to the preparation of
the Final plat.

If the preliminary plat is approved by the City
Council, the developer, before requesting final
approval, shall elect to install or assure installa-
tion of the improvements required by Section 6 of
this ordinance by one of the following methods:
1. Actual installation of the required
improvements, to the satisfaction and approval of
the City Engineer;
2. (A) Furnishing to the City a subdivision
bond, with an approved insurer, in an amount equal
to the cost of the improvements as determined by
the City Engineer, which bond shall assure to the
City actual installation of the required improve-
ments to the satisfaction and approval of the City
Engineer. The City Engineer shall determine the
period of the bond.
(B) Furnishing to the City an assignment
of a savings account or placing in trust, an amount
equal to the cost of the improvements as determined
by the City Engineer, which assignment of savings
account or trust shall assure to the City the instal-
lation of the improvements, to the satisfaction and
approval of the City Engineer. This savings account
or trust shall be conditioned so that no amount may
be removed therefrom without prior written approval
of the City, and shall further provide that, if the
improvements are not installed within the time
limitations set by the City Engineer, or not installed
to the satisfaction of the City Engineer, then the
City may withdraw from the savings account or trust
the amount necessary to complete the improvement.
The City Engineer shall determine the period of the
assignment of the savings account or the trust.
After completion of all required improvements
the City Engineer and any government agency involved
shall submit a written notice to the Planning Com-
mission stating that the developer has completed the
required improvements in accordance with Section 6 and
with required installation standards.
The Subdivision Administrator shall send a written
notice to the developer advising him to prepare a Final
plat for that portion of the area contained in the
Preliminary plat in which the required improvements
have been installed.
FINAL APPROVAL The Final plat shall conform to
the Preliminary plat as approved by the Planning
Commission. If desired by the developer, the Final
plat may constitute only that portion of the approved
Preliminary plat which he proposes to record and develop
at the time.
The Final plat shall be submitted to the Planning
Commission within twelve months after Commission approval
of the Preliminary plat. Said approval shall become
void unless an extension of time is granted by the
Planning Commission.
The developer shall submit a mylar tracing and six
prints or more if required of his Final plat and other
required exhibits to the Subdivision Administrator at
least fourteen days prior to the meeting in which the
Final plat is to be considered by the Planning Commission.
Ten days prior to the public hearing of the Commis-
sion in which the Final plat is to be considered, the
developer shall post three notices regarding said hearing.
•
•
The Planning Commission shall review the Final
plat to determine if the plat conforms with the
Preliminary plat, the provisions of the Comprehensive
Plan, the Zoning Regulations and these Subdivision
Regulations. Within sixty days the Commission shall
act upon the Final plat.
If the Commission approves the Final plat the
Chairman shall sign the Final tracing. If the Com-
mission disapproves the Final plat it shall express
its reasons for disapproval, and shall give written
notice to the developer of its action.
Following the approval of the Final plat by the
Commission the Subdivision Administrator shall obtain
the signatures of the County Health Officer (if
required by Commission), the City Engineer, City
Clerk, City Manager and City Attorney on the Final
tracing and shall submit the tracing of the Final plat
to the City Council for approval and signature by the
Mayor.
The developer shall have his Final plat recorded
within thirty (30) days from the date his Final plat
is approved by the City Council.
After obtaining signatures of City officials and
prior to thirty days after recording, the developer
shall obtain and give to the City Engineer a mylar or
equivalent duplicate of the Final plat.
APPROVAL AND REVIEW OF PRELIMINARY AND FINAL PLATS
When:a proposed plat or subdivision is situated adjacent
to the right -of -way of state highways, said plat or
subdivision shall be submitted to the Director of High-
ways. Approval by the Commission shall be withheld until
said Director or his assistant has made a report to the
Commission.
When a proposed plat, subdivision or dedication is
adjacent to unincorporated territory notice of such
proposed plat shall be given by the Subdivision Admin-
istrator to the Clallam County Planning Commission.
Any decision by the City Council approving or
refusing to approve a plat or subdivision shall be
reviewable for arbitrary, capricious or corrupt action
or non - action, by writ of review before the Superior
Court of Clallam County, by any property owner of the
county having jurisdiction thereof who deems himself
agrieved thereby. Provided, that due application for
such writ of review shall be made to such court within
thirty days from the date of any decision so to be
reviewed."
